What is currently in place to support the cygwinxxx.dll in the MS Visual Studio environment?  My question is based on the need to find a replacement/alternative to the Microsoft C runtime library since it requires a large commitment of memory for each process using the library.  If I can staticly link the functionality of your dll into our program we would have an alternate C runtime library.  Is there already an implementation available that I could link to?
